Zahir Porter (born January 11, 2000) is an American professional basketball player who played for BK Iskra Svit of the Slovak Basketball League.
Porter attended Our Saviour Lutheran School in Bronx, NY where he averaged 14.6 points per game as a senior. He played three seasons of varsity basketball.
In 2018, Porter committed to New York Institute of Technology.[1] He averaged 12.2 points and 2.9 rebounds per game.
In 2019, Porter transferred to Independence Community College.[2] He averaged 10.1 points and 3 rebounds per game.
In April 2020, Porter transferred to Weber State University.[3]
During the 2020–2021 season, he played in 22 games and started in 21 games. He finished third on the team in scoring at 12 points per game.
During the 2021–2022 season, he played in all 33 games. He averaged 5.8 points.
In his final season, he played in all 33 games as a senior. He averaged 6 points per game.[4]
On October 9, 2023, Porter signed with BC Kamza Basket for the season.[5]
On November 7, 2023, Porter received Hoops Agents Player of the Week award for Round 5. He had 57 points, 4 rebounds and 5 assists for his team's win.[6]
On August 14, 2024, Porter signed with BK Iskra Svit for the season.[7] On October 24, 2024, Porter left the team after playing in 5 games where he averaged 21.6 points, 3.8 rebounds and 2.8 assists per game.[8]
Porter is the son of Erin Porter and Yolanda Roberson. He has two siblings, Zion and Ari.[9]
